Meet the Domainex Team: Cameron Haddow

Cameron headshot

Cameron Haddow joined the Domainex team in July 2021 as a Scientist within the assay biology team. For our next ‘Meet the team’ blog, Cameron tells us a bit more about his role at Domainex and his experience to date.

How did you get into a career in drug discovery?

“I took an A-level in biology and enjoyed the small amount of biochemistry included in the course, so I decided to study for a degree in biochemistry at the University of Bath. I wanted to get a taste of what working in industry would be like, so I selected a course which included a placement year which I undertook at AstraZeneca. I enjoyed the placement so much that I wanted to continue working in industry post-university.”

Can you give us a brief insight into your day-to-day activities?

“I usually spend my time developing and running biophysics-based assays. Often this uses our Grating-Coupled Interferometry (GCI) and MicroScale Thermophoresis (MST) instruments, so I usually spend my mornings immobilising or labelling proteins ready for compound testing during the afternoon. I typically spend my afternoons between the lab and write-up areas, setting up experiments and writing them up or completing other tasks such as preparing slides for meetings or preparing proposals for prospective clients.”
